android
文章平均质量分 51
菲仔
只有非常努力,才能轻松如意。
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
gradle task build 渠道包
然后在右侧的gradle工具栏中选择Task->build->buildAllFlavors或者buildMeterFlavors即可。在app下的build.gradle下编写。也可以自定义某几个渠道包。build所有渠道包。原创 2025-09-29 15:25:01 · 212 阅读 · 0 评论 -
android中监听Bean实体类字段更新
在项目中想要监听某个Bean实体类的字段更新后需要处理相关逻辑,可以使用如下方法。原创 2025-09-28 17:57:19 · 90 阅读 · 0 评论 -
记录关于CoroutineScope.cancel()的问题。
在项目中遇到一个问题,在前台service执行逻辑时,在onStartCommand中使用serviceScope.launch {}前调用了serviceScope..cancel(),导致后续所有的launch都无效。其中private val serviceScope = CoroutineScope(Dispatchers.IO + Job())后来发现serviceScope..cancel()取消的是当前作用域下的所有协程,不管是之前还是之后创建的。原创 2025-09-28 17:47:50 · 131 阅读 · 0 评论 -
关于遇到java.util.concurrent.RejectedExecutionException: Task java.util.concurrent.FutureTask
在app中使用了线程池,在车机系统自动切换主题时导致此问题,从日志中来看当前常驻线程为3且线程池未close,非常奇怪,当前没有深究到底是何原因触发此问题,有大佬知道可以留言下。目前不知道有啥更好的办法来处理此问题,若有大佬有思路或者有解决方法可以留言哈。我这边目前是这么解决的,其中delayRunTask为重新执行任务。此问题承接上篇socket文档。原创 2025-09-28 10:37:45 · 219 阅读 · 0 评论 -
关于服务端ServerSocket及客户端Socket
1.创建ServerSocket50,SERVER_SOCKET_PORT为端口号,SERVER_CLIENT_SOCKET_IP客户端的IP2.等待客户端连接!.accept()} else {3.接收消息) {!4.发送消息try {return!原创 2025-09-28 10:13:09 · 513 阅读 · 0 评论 -
【Android】开发中,webview遇到的css问题
1.给webview设置css时,我们可能会这么做在p标签中设置了颜色值 #475669,在华为、vivo等中并未报错,webview可以加载出来,但在小米(red mi k20)机型上,出现webview加载不出来,经过一番调试,问题出在color颜色上,解决办法:将color颜色换成rgb(0,0,0)就OK。...原创 2019-10-21 11:36:22 · 1071 阅读 · 0 评论 -
从创建flutter到打包成aar,并运行,这之间踩过的坑!!
flutter1.首先先创建一个flutter project:pubspec.yaml配置文件,主要导入第三方包、image、font等资源文件; lib,主要目录,编写dart代码;主入口main.dart; 一些第三方的包(兼容androidX):2.将flutter项目打包成aar,需要引入fat-aar,主要是要将第三包中与android交互的源码导入进来;首先在a...原创 2019-07-29 20:12:02 · 6573 阅读 · 5 评论 -
android--通过OkHttp3拦截token失效
整体流程:1. 请求一接口:比如 test2.先拦截test的http code:若是401则拦截,再通过refreshToken获取最新的access_token及refresh_token,3.再通过Request重新触发请求,请求test接口 话不多说,直接贴代码首先创建okHttpBuilderOkHttpClient.Builder okHttpBuilder...原创 2018-09-14 12:11:50 · 2765 阅读 · 0 评论 -
android APK打包
1. 首先把R.java打包: >sdk/platform-tools/aapt package -f -m -J /打包的路径 -S /项目路径/res -I sdk/platforms/android-7/android.jar -M /项目路径/AndroidManifest.xml -J 要打包的路径 -S 项目的res路径 -I anroidSDK/an...转载 2018-08-26 11:31:39 · 606 阅读 · 0 评论 -
android基础知识
四大组件是什么与它们的生命周期(及Fragment)。 Acitivty的四种启动模式与特点。 Activity状态保存与恢复。 Service的生命周期,启动方法,有什么区别。 service和activity怎么进行数据交互。 怎么保证service不被杀死。 广播使用的方式和场景以及广播的几种分类。 Intent的使用...原创 2018-08-26 11:22:49 · 308 阅读 · 0 评论 -
android-奇异bug:parameter must be a descendant of this view
项目上线后遇到一个问题:java.lang.IllegalArgumentException: parameter must be a descendant of this viewat android.view.ViewGroup.offsetRectBetweenParentAndChild(ViewGroup.java:5336)at android.view.ViewGroup原创 2017-03-16 19:17:36 · 2299 阅读 · 0 评论 -
总结android日常用到的注意点
android日常注意点原创 2015-12-25 17:35:23 · 802 阅读 · 0 评论 -
2015.6项目经历总结
项目总结原创 2015-12-22 16:09:34 · 587 阅读 · 0 评论 -
git学习推荐
git快速学习转载 2016-01-04 14:14:11 · 627 阅读 · 0 评论 -
AS通过git clone 项目代码
AS通过git clone代码原创 2015-12-31 11:59:19 · 1804 阅读 · 0 评论 -
安装JDK1.8.0_66的坑
安装JDK引发的as打不开原创 2015-12-31 10:59:09 · 7120 阅读 · 0 评论 -
android 新浪微博SDK 3.0.1分享
android 使用新浪微博SDK3.0.1的代码流程.原创 2015-02-13 16:07:23 · 1039 阅读 · 0 评论 -
有关apache mina框架的编码问题
直接上代码:public class MinaServer {public static void main(String[] args) {IoAcceptor acceptor = new NioSocketAcceptor();acceptor.getSessionConfig().setReadBufferSize(2048);// 缓存大小ac原创 2014-09-02 17:49:47 · 703 阅读 · 0 评论 -
apache MINA框架的编码问题
首先声明: MINA框架收发都使用bytebuffer;客户端代码:原创 2014-09-02 17:58:01 · 571 阅读 · 0 评论
分享